Clematis fremontii S. Watson. Subgenus: Viorna. Fremont’s Leatherflower. Phen: Apr-May. Hab: Calcareous flatwoods and limestone or dolomite glades. Dist: E. MO, s. MO, nc. KS and sc. NE; disjunct in the Ridge and Valley of nw. GA (Floyd County) and se. TN (Hamilton County)
Origin/Endemic status: Native
Syn: = C, FNA3, GrPl, K1, K3, Tn; = Coriflora fremontii (S.Watson) W.A.Weber – Weber (1995); = Viorna fremontii (S.Watson) A.Heller; > Clematis fremontii S.Watson var. riehlii R.O.Erickson – F
